How is SEO Used?

SEO keywords and key phrases that are relevant to both a business, and what people are searching for to find said business, are inserted into the content of websites.

These keywords will be included in website pages, product descriptions, articles and blogs on websites, and even places like titles, adverts themselves and the descriptions you find underneath the titles on Google (these are known as meta descriptions).

SEO is the not so secret, secret little tactic that gets businesses found. You can also think of it as being similar to hashtags that users put on their social media posts to be found by other people that share the same interests.

How Digital Marketers Create SEO Strategies

A digital marketing agency will have SEO experts that can analyse and understand what search terms people use. They can then utilise this knowledge of common phrasing and words used when people search for a service to decide what SEO keywords to apply to, and boost, your business.

The SEO team will work alongside the marketing and content writing team to work those keywords into the written content on your website.

Not only this, but after this SEO based content is added. A good digital marketing agency will continue to keep an eye on the results, tracking and measuring progress to share with you. They’ll let you know how your website has been doing, sharing statistics of traffic and conversions. They’ll also use this information to continue improving with each piece of new content you hire them to make.
